Painting Description
"Natures Mortes Aux Fruits" is a notable work by the French artist Alfred Arthur Brunel de Neuville (1852–1941), who was renowned for his still-life paintings, particularly those depicting fruits and animals. This painting, whose title translates to "Still Life with Fruits" in English, exemplifies Brunel de Neuville's mastery in capturing the texture, color, and realism of still-life subjects, contributing significantly to his reputation in the genre during the late 19th and early 20th centuries.
Alfred Arthur Brunel de Neuville belonged to the school of French realism, and his works often reflected a meticulous attention to detail and a vibrant use of color. "Natures Mortes Aux Fruits" showcases a variety of fruits, possibly including apples, grapes, and peaches, arranged in a naturalistic setting that highlights their freshness and ripeness. The composition, lighting, and perspective in the painting are carefully constructed to draw the viewer's eye across the canvas, showcasing the artist's skill in creating a sense of depth and volume.
This painting is representative of Brunel de Neuville's broader body of work, which frequently celebrated the beauty and simplicity of everyday objects. Through his paintings, he aimed to evoke a sense of appreciation for the mundane, elevating the status of still-life painting within the hierarchy of genres in art history. "Natures Mortes Aux Fruits" not only reflects Brunel de Neuville's technical prowess but also his ability to imbue his subjects with a sense of life and vitality, making his works enduringly popular with both contemporaries and modern audiences.
As with many of Brunel de Neuville's paintings, "Natures Mortes Aux Fruits" likely found its audience among the burgeoning middle class of the time, who appreciated the beauty and accessibility of his still-life compositions. Today, his works are appreciated for their contribution to the still-life genre and are collected and exhibited by art enthusiasts and museums around the world, testament to Brunel de Neuville's enduring legacy in the world of art.
